Q: Is 136,021,506 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 136,021,506 is not a prime number.

Why is 136,021,506 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 136021506 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 643 1,286 1,929 3,858 35,257 70,514 105,771 211,542 22,670,251 45,340,502 68,010,753 and 136,021,506, with no remainder.

Since 136,021,506 cannot be divided by just 1 and 136,021,506, it is not a prime number.
